Hours after submitting her resignation, Khushbu Sundar, the former Spokesperson of the All India Congress Committee (AICC,) joined the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P.)

On the afternoon of the 12th of October, the actress turned politician joined the BJP in Delhi.

Along with Khushbu Sundar, Madan Ravichandran, a political journalist, and former Indian Revenue Service (IRS) officer Saravana Kumar, also joined the BJP.

Ms. Sundar submitted her resignation to Sonia Gandhi, the interim President of the INC, today morning after she was dropped as the AICC Spokesperson.

In her resignation letter to the interim President of the Congress party, Sonia Gandhi, Ms. undar said, “Few elements seated at higher level within the party, people who’ve no connectivity with ground reality or public recognition, are dictating terms.”

The conflict between the INC and Khushbu Sundar was visible soon after she welcomed BJP’s recent National Education Policy (NEP), 2020.

In regard to this, INC Leaders from Tamil Nadu attacked her over her stance, following which she apologised to the former Congress president Rahul Gandhi.

The joining of BJP event held in Delhi was a low key affair in the wake of the Novel Coronavirus pandemic.

Only a few BJP leaders were present during the event and welcomed Ms. Khushbu Sundar.
